French ditch installation services involve creating a drainage system designed to manage excess water around residential or commercial properties. These services typically include excavating a trench, installing a drainage pipe, and covering it with gravel or other materials to facilitate effective water runoff. The goal is to direct water away from foundations, basements, or other vulnerable areas to prevent water accumulation and related issues. Professional installers assess the property’s landscape and water flow patterns to design a system that effectively mitigates drainage problems.
This service addresses common issues such as basement flooding, foundation damage, soil erosion, and pooling water in yards. Poor drainage can lead to structural instability, mold growth, and damage to landscaping or outdoor structures. French drain installation helps resolve these problems by providing a reliable pathway for water to escape, reducing moisture buildup and protecting the integrity of the property. Properly installed drainage systems can also improve outdoor usability by eliminating soggy or muddy areas caused by poor water runoff.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a French ditch typ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the length and complexity of the project. For example, a standard 50-foot French drain may cost around $2,500. Costs can vary based on site conditions and material choices.
Material Expenses - Material costs for French ditch installation generally fall between $10 and $25 per linear foot. This includes the price of gravel, perforated piping, and filter fabric. Higher-quality materials may increase overall expenses.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for local pros usually range from $50 to $100 per hour, with total labor costs depending on project size. A typical installation might require 10 to 20 hours of work, influencing the final price.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include site preparation, grading, and permits, which can add $500 to $1,500 to the total. These costs vary based on site accessibility and spec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
